如何正确编写C语言错误函数
在C语言中,编写错误处理函数是非常重要的,可以帮助我们更好地处理程序中可能出现的异常情况。下面将介绍如何正确编写C语言的错误函数。
编写错误函数的整体框架
首先,在编写错误函数时,我们需要定义一个整体的函数框架。可以使用类似于【Wrong】的函数名来表示这是一个错误处理函数。
```c
void Wrong() {
// 在这里编写错误处理的具体逻辑
}
```
使用花括号定义函数范围
在定义错误处理函数时,一定要使用花括号来明确函数的范围。花括号内包含的代码将会在调用错误函数时被执行。
```c
void Wrong() {
// 错误处理代码写在这里
}
```
协商提示内容
在编写错误函数时,可以添加一些提示信息,让用户能够更清晰地了解发生了什么错误以及如何解决。
```c
void Wrong() {
printf("Error: Something went wrong. Please check your input.
");
}
```
Main函数位置注意事项
当编写C程序时,Main函数通常是程序的入口点,如果在Main函数之后调用了错误处理函数,需要在Main函数之前进行声明。
```c
// 声明错误处理函数
void Wrong();
int main() {
// 主函数代码写在这里
return 0;
}
// 错误处理函数定义
void Wrong() {
printf("Error: Something went wrong. Please check your input.
");
}
```
使用分号结束语句
在C语言中,每条语句都需要以分号结尾,包括函数声明、定义以及其他语句。
```c
void Wrong() {
printf("Error: Something went wrong. Please check your input.
");
}
```
通过以上方法,我们可以正确编写C语言的错误处理函数,提高程序的健壮性和可靠性。在实际的编程过程中,合理处理错误是非常重要的,可以避免程序崩溃或产生不可预料的结果。希望以上内容对你有所帮助!
版权声明:本文内容由互联网用户自发贡献,本站不承担相关法律责任.如有侵权/违法内容,本站将立刻删除。